Anyone else not able to install the demo? (Win 7) I run the setup file and there is nothing in the VST folder I selected to install to. I tried running the demo setup from the desktop like the README suggests and still nothing.

Post

Is this win7 64 or 32bit OS?

32 or 64bit host?

You may try a manual install. To do so please try the following:

1) In the /pkg/ folder of the installer folder you will find a "2C-Aether-Demo" folder. This folder supplies all related resource files needed by Aether. Please move/copy this folder to your shared VST plug-ins folder for your host where you store other 3rd party plug-ins.

32bitOS/32bitHost: c://Program Files/.../VSTplugins/2C-Aether-Demo/ or similar.
64bitOS/64bitHost: c://Program Files/.../VSTplugins/2C-Aether-Demo/ or similar.
64bitOS/32bitHost: c://Program Files(x86)/.../VSTplugins/2C-Aether-Demo/ or similar.


2) Go back to the downloaded installer folder and you will find a "VSTDLL" folder. Inside this folder are the both the 64bit and the 32bit versions of the plugin. x64 is 64bit. x86 is 32bit.

If you are using a 32bit host open the x86 folder and copy "2c-aether-demo.dll" into the new folder you created above in step 1.

If you are using a 64bit host open the x64 folder and copy "2c-aether-demo.dll" into the new folder you created above in step 1.

3) Launch your host and rescan plug-ins if necessary.

Please let us know how it goes.
